I think I'm in love...this little toy is much more than I had ever hoped for. I don't have one single negitive thing to say about it.
All my friends are toting around their monster laptops just to be able to get on line at the coffee shop...you should have seen the shade of green their faces turned when I reached into my shirt pocket to join them in an online search. You would have thought it was St. Patricks Day.
I was able to [thanks to this forum] figure out the e-mail client and set up all three of my g-mail accounts...works very smoothly!
I've trained my handwriting recoginition and it's proven to work quite well...but the key board is so fast that I only use the handwriting to impress
I am glad I read the booklet though. Iearned a couple of things it may have taken me awhile to discover...like the optimal view...it's great being able to read the pages without my glasses. I thought I might be in trouble until I discovered that. I love the resolution when I kick a page up to 250% and I don't have to keep scrolling back and forth since it automatically re-aligns everything.
This is one sweet machine...
